Mt. Vernon topped Newark Licking Valley 46-45 in a tough tilt in an Ohio boys basketball matchup on Jan. 23.

Mt. Vernon opened with a 19-17 advantage over Newark Licking Valley through the first quarter.

The scoreboard showed the Panthers with a 26-24 lead over the Yellow Jackets heading into the second quarter.

Mt. Vernon broke in front at the beginning of the final quarter with a 34-33 lead over Newark Licking Valley.

Neither team could gain any advantage in the final quarter.

In recent action on Jan. 13, Newark Licking Valley faced off against Pataskala Licking Hts. and Mt. Vernon took on Pataskala Licking Hts. on Jan. 16 at Licking Heights High School.
